Golden Jaguars to play Trinidad, Indonesia in Friendly Internatio­nals next month

The Golden Jaguars will return to the Internatio­nal Circuit in the month of November after being invited by the Trinidad and Tobago and the Indonesia Football Associatio­n respective­ly for overseas Internatio­nal Friendlies.

According to a release from the Guyana Football Federation (GFF), the Trinidad and Tobago Football Associatio­n will host the match on November 14th while Indonesia will stage their match on the 25th. The Golden Jaguars will lock horns with an Indonesian Premier League club in a warm fixture, prior to the internatio­nal fixture.

“This will be the first time we’ve played outside of the Confederat­ion or played in Asia. It will be a fantastic opportunit­y for our players to experience a different type of play and a different type of opposition. The GFF Technical Department has been pushing our players to have adaptable skills and function effectivel­y in any environmen­t as we are looking to build in 2018 which will be a competitiv­e year,” said GFF’s Ian Greenwood.

Meanwhile, Interim-Head Coach Wayne Dover said, “These games are very important as they will allow for assessment of our team’s caliber and serve as platforms to expose our local talent. Should we get a positive result it will argue well for sponsorshi­p, attract more local players to the fraternity and improve our Federation of Internatio­nal Football Associatio­n (FIFA) ranking. All this will serve to create a firm national team that can truly reflect a strong Guyana National Team.”
